What do you know? We now have 8 planets in our solar system…. ( Mercury, Venus, Earth, Mars, Jupiter, Saturn, Uranus, Neptune… ) Nope Pluto has not blow up or anything… It’s just that it’s planetary status has just been downgraded to a category know as “dwarf planet”. Who’s to blame? Eris.

“A distant, icy rock whose discovery shook up the solar system and led to Pluto’s planetary demise has been given a name: Eris. Since its discovery last year, Eris ignited a debate about what constitutes a planet. Astronomers were split over how to classify the object because there was no universal definition. Some argued it should be welcomed as the 10th planet since it was larger than Pluto, but others felt Pluto was not a full-fledged planet.
After much bickering, astronomers last month voted to shrink the solar system to eight planets, downgrading Pluto to a dwarf planet, a category that also includes Eris and the asteroid Ceres.”
